Comprehending Fascia and Gutters: Their ImportanceWhat is Fascia?
Fascia Replacement is the horizontal board that runs along the lower edge of the roofing, generally where the roof fulfills the outside wall. It serves not only a decorative function however also acts as an important support structure for the lower edge of the roofing and a base for the gutter system.
What are Gutters?
Seamless gutters are troughs set up along the eaves of your roofing that gather and direct rainwater away from your home. They play an important function in preventing water from pooling around your structure, Professional Fascia Replacement which can cause costly structural damage.
The Relationship Between Fascia and Gutters
Fascia and gutters work together. Gutters are connected to the fascia board, producing a system created to successfully funnel rainwater off the roof and away from the home. When either element fails, it can cause substantial water damage, including rot, mold growth, and even foundation issues.
Signs You Need to Replace Fascia and Gutters
It's vital for homeowners to be familiar with the signs that suggest a need for replacement. Below are some common signs:
SignDescriptionDecomposing or Cracked FasciaVisible decay or cracking in the fascia board can signal water damage.Sagging GuttersIf gutters are pulling away from the fascia, they may be overwhelmed with debris or water.Water DamageDiscolorations on walls or ceilings can indicate inappropriate water drain.Overruning GuttersIf water overflows the edges of the rain gutters, they might be clogged or too small.Mold GrowthThe existence of mold around the fascia or under the Eaves Replacement can signify prolonged moisture issues.Peeling PaintFlaking or bubbling paint on the fascia or siding may indicate underlying water problems.Steps for Fascia and Gutter Replacement

How typically should I replace my fascia and rain gutters?
The life expectancy of fascia and seamless gutters differs based on the products utilized and regional environment. Generally, seamless gutters last 20-50 years and fascia can last up to 30 years. Routine inspections are essential to determine when replacement is essential.

How can I preserve my fascia and gutters?
Regular maintenance consists of cleaning seamless gutters a minimum of twice a year, checking for damage after storms, and painting or sealing the fascia to secure it from wetness.
5. What is the expense of fascia and gutter replacement?
Expenses vary significantly based on product choice, labor, and the size of the home. Usually, homeowners can anticipate to pay anywhere from ₤ 1,000 to ₤ 3,000 for total replacement.
